In fact, donor records can decay at rates approaching 30% annually without regular maintenance.<\/p>\n<p>Keeping your data healthy isn\u2019t just about organization\u2014it\u2019s about making sure every supporter relationship is fully understood and nurtured.<\/p>\n<h2>Routine vs. periodic cleanup activities<\/h2>\n<p>Some CRM cleanup tasks happen regularly, while others require deeper, periodic review.<\/p>\n<p>Routine cleanup tasks are typically performed weekly or monthly to prevent small issues from growing into larger problems. These include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/bloomerang.com\/news\/new-feature-real-time-duplicate-constituent-management\/\">Identifying duplicate records<\/a> created across multiple giving channels<\/li>\n<li>Processing email bounces after campaigns<\/li>\n<li>Reviewing new data entries for completeness and accuracy<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Periodic cleanup activities, performed quarterly or annually, involve broader database reviews. These may include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Auditing inactive donor records<\/li>\n<li>Reviewing naming conventions across the database<\/li>\n<li>Standardizing mailing addresses and phone numbers<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>The connection between consistent maintenance and database health is clear. Organizations that conduct regular cleanup catch issues early, while those that rely solely on occasional audits often face time-consuming correction projects later.<\/p>\n<p>Routine care keeps your CRM ready for action.<\/p>\n<h2>Data quality maintenance goals<\/h2>\n<p>Four core goals guide effective CRM data cleanup: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Accuracy<\/strong><br \/>\nEnsure donor contact information, giving histories, and preferences reflect reality.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Completeness<\/strong><br \/>\nFill in missing data so you have a full picture of each supporter.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Consistency<\/strong><br \/>\nMaintain standardized formatting so data can be searched, segmented, and analyzed.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Timeliness<\/strong><br \/>\nKeep records up to date as donors move, change jobs, or update preferences.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>These goals directly support stronger fundraising outcomes.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Accurate data enables personalized outreach to major donors.<\/li>\n<li>Complete records support thoughtful acknowledgment and stewardship.<\/li>\n<li>Consistent formatting powers targeted segmentation.<\/li>\n<li>Timely updates prevent wasted mail and communication errors.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>When nonprofits maintain clean data, their outreach becomes more personal, more effective, and more impactful.<\/p>\n<p>That\u2019s why CRM cleanup is more than just administrative work\u2014it\u2019s relationship work.<\/p>\n<h2>Essential types of CRM cleanup tasks<\/h2>\n<p>Five core categories of cleanup tasks form the foundation of effective donor database maintenance. Each one addresses common ways that incomplete or inconsistent data enters your CRM.<\/p>\n<p>Together, they keep your database ready to support stronger supporter relationships.<\/p>\n<h3>Duplicate record management<\/h3>\n<p>Duplicate records are one of the most visible\u2014and frustrating\u2014data issues in donor management systems.<\/p>\n<p>The same supporter might appear multiple times in your database: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Robert Smith<\/li>\n<li>Bob Smith<\/li>\n<li>R. Smith<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>When this happens, your team loses a complete view of that donor\u2019s relationship with your organization.<\/p>\n<p>Identifying and merging duplicate records typically involves matching fields like: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Email addresses<\/li>\n<li>Mailing addresses<\/li>\n<li>Phone numbers<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Duplicates create real operational challenges. They inflate contact counts, distort giving reports, and can lead to donors receiving multiple appeals or conflicting communications.<\/p>\n<p>For many organizations with large databases, duplicates can represent 15\u201320% of records.<\/p>\n<p>Cleaning them up helps you see each supporter clearly and steward them thoughtfully.<\/p>\n<h3>Contact information verification<\/h3>\n<p>Contact verification ensures your messages actually reach your supporters.<\/p>\n<p>These tasks include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Email validation to confirm addresses can receive messages<\/li>\n<li>Mailing address verification for deliverability and formatting<\/li>\n<li>Phone number standardization for consistent contact records<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>The impact is significant. <strong>If 10\u201315% of emails bounce, campaign performance drops<\/strong>, and sender reputation can suffer.<\/p>\n<p>Verified contact information means your appeals, updates, and gratitude reach the people who care about your mission.<\/p>\n<h3>Data standardization tasks<\/h3>\n<p>Standardization keeps your data consistent across the entire database.<\/p>\n<p>This includes: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Standard name formats<\/li>\n<li>Consistent address abbreviations<\/li>\n<li>Defined giving levels<\/li>\n<li>Clear campaign naming conventions<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Without standardization, the same information may appear in multiple formats, making segmentation and reporting difficult.<\/p>\n<p>For example: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>\u201cCalifornia\u201d vs \u201cCA\u201d vs \u201cCalif.\u201d<\/li>\n<li>Inconsistent job titles for corporate donors<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Standardization ensures your data works the way your team needs it to.<\/p>\n<p>When everything speaks the same language, your CRM becomes a powerful strategic tool.<\/p>\n<h2>Step-by-step CRM cleanup implementation<\/h2>\n<p>Establishing regular cleanup routines transforms data hygiene from an overwhelming project into a manageable habit.<\/p>\n<p>With the right framework, nonprofit teams can keep their CRM healthy without overloading staff time.<\/p>\n<h3>Weekly cleanup procedures<\/h3>\n<p>Weekly maintenance prevents small issues from turning into bigger problems. Set aside 30\u201345 minutes for these tasks:<\/p>\n<ol>\n<li><strong>Review new records (10 minutes)<\/strong>Scan records created during the past week for incomplete data, obvious errors, or missing required fields.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Run duplicate scans (10 minutes)<\/strong>Use your CRM\u2019s duplicate detection tool to identify potential matches. Merge clear duplicates and flag uncertain matches for review.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Process email bounces (10 minutes)<\/strong>Review bounced emails from recent campaigns. Update invalid addresses and remove hard bounces.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Flag incomplete records (10 minutes)<\/strong>Identify records missing critical fields and assign follow-up tasks to gather missing information.<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p>These tasks are often managed by a development coordinator or database administrator, with volunteers assisting during busy fundraising periods.<\/p>\n<h3>Monthly deep cleanup activities<\/h3>\n<p>Monthly tasks allow for more comprehensive database maintenance.<\/p>\n<p>Typical activities include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Auditing data entry for naming convention compliance<\/li>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/bloomerang.com\/blog\/the-ultimate-guide-to-ncoa-processing\/\">Standardizing new mailing addresses and phone numbers<\/a><\/li>\n<li>Updating donor segments based on recent activity<\/li>\n<li>Reviewing flagged records from weekly cleanup<\/li>\n<li>Processing returned mail and address updates<\/li>\n<li>Flagging contacts inactive for 12+ months<\/li>\n<li>Verifying major donor records are complete<\/li>\n<li>Running reports to identify recurring data issues<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Organizations with databases <strong>under 10,000 records<\/strong> typically spend <strong>2\u20133 hours per month<\/strong> on these activities.<\/p>\n<p>Larger databases may require additional time or distributed responsibilities across team members.<\/p>\n<h2>Cleanup task comparison by frequency<\/h2>\n<table style=\"border-collapse: collapse;
